Web6 apr. 2024 · Surface water evaporates (water to water vapor) or sublimates (ice to water vapor), which deposits large amounts of water vapor into the atmosphere. Water vapor in the atmosphere condenses into clouds and is eventually followed by precipitation, which returns water to the earth’s surface. Web27 sep. 2024 · Water from plants and trees also enters the atmosphere. This is called transpiration. Warm water vapor rises up through Earth’s atmosphere. As the water vapor rises higher and higher, the cool air of the atmosphere causes the water vapor to turn back into liquid water, creating clouds.
